Career path

Career Role (Plant Genetics & Plant Gene Manipulation) Description
Plant Geneticist Develops and applies genetic engineering techniques to improve crop yields and quality. High demand in agricultural biotechnology.
Plant Molecular Biologist Conducts research into plant molecular mechanisms, using gene manipulation to understand and improve plant traits. Essential for genetic improvement.
Crop Improvement Specialist Applies genetic knowledge to breed superior crop varieties; critical for food security and sustainable agriculture.
Agricultural Biotechnologist Works on the application of biotechnology in agriculture, often involving plant gene manipulation for pest resistance or enhanced nutrition. Growing demand in the UK.
Research Scientist (Plant Genetics) Conducts fundamental or applied research in plant genetics, contributing to advancements in plant gene manipulation. Competitive salaries.
